Output 32fdc6668e219ffe0348811fbe854af7fa17a83c592165974663bfbb88241259:20

value
14500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f14f772129ffc0dbc9b8d1cdcdb014ae90583083 OP_EQUAL
address
AESChyDuakphb79xq8JJq3bDDYppwzw2Kj
transaction
32fdc6668e219ffe0348811fbe854af7fa17a83c592165974663bfbb88241259